Sarodih Population - Rohtas, Bihar

Sarodih is a medium size village located in Kargahar Block of Rohtas district, Bihar with total 117 families residing. The Sarodih village has population of 769 of which 414 are males while 355 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sarodih village population of children with age 0-6 is 142 which makes up 18.47 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sarodih village is 857 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Sarodih as per census is 1119, higher than Bihar average of 935.

Sarodih village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Sarodih village was 73.37 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Sarodih Male literacy stands at 81.27 % while female literacy rate was 63.57 %.

Caste Factor

In Sarodih village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 55.79 % of total population in Sarodih village. The village Sarodih curr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Sarodih village out of total population, 168 were engaged in work activities. 46.43 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 53.57 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 168 workers engaged in Main Work, 54 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 9 were Agricultural labourer.
